If you are ordered to pay Child Support in Colorado Springs, CO there are many factors which come into play to factor what your payments will be. How many children there are, the incomes of both parents and daycare costs are just a few. It can be easy sometimes to agree to everything asked of you by your ex-spouse, or the courts without question. But this cooperation can be costly, especially if your children are young.
